Residential Guest Relations Coordinator (2 Openings)
The Residential Coordinator (known internally as Residential Elite Coordinator) plays an integral role in elevating the Four Seasons’ experience for our Residential Homeowners as they live and travel the brand.
This role is responsible for fostering strong connections and building lasting relationships with our Residential homeowners. The position ensures a seamless travel experience from start to finish by leveraging various tools and platforms to create tailored proposals, confirm reservations, and coordinate additional bookings.
The RC will provide essential support to the Residential Supervisor by handling administrative responsibilities, including enrollments and removals, updating marketing subscriptions, assisting with global inquiries, and more. Additionally, the RC will monitor daily revenue and generate monthly data reports to maintain clean, accurate records in Salesforce.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to cultivate positive guest relationships are critical, as the RC will deliver exceptional, start-to-finish service for our Residential homeowners.

What You’ll Be Doing:
Residential Contact
- The Residential Coordinator is responsible for connecting with new and existing homeowners to establish a relationship and encourage them to travel the brand. They will support the Residential Supervisor and our global properties by performing all functions for new homeowners.
- Service – Having a clear and in depth understanding of brand expectations for Residential homeowners and beneficiaries.
- Homeowner Contact & Interaction– Performing new owner onboarding and welcome to the Service.
- Profile Creation & Enrollment – Create profiles, ensuring complete, accurate data, and enroll in Salesforce.
Residential Travel
- The Residential Coordinator will utilize ORS to obtain rates and availability and to finalize travel bookings for homeowners, ensuring a high degree of accuracy when making reservations.
- Use a consultative sales approach to identify/anticipate guests’ needs and make relevant recommendations.
- Actively seek opportunities to upsell and cross-sell additional services that add value to the guest experience.
- Liaise with property teams to flag guest arrivals, including pertinent information such as arrival time, flight info, transportation arrangements, meet & greet, local recommendations, and hotel information as needed.
- Ensure Residential homeowners and beneficiaries are accurately enrolled and receive the benefits of the service when traveling to other properties.
- Perform feedback debrief from homeowner and property after travel to identify opportunities, profile updates or any other areas for action.
- Regularly monitor for glitches and feedback.
- Respectfully and tactfully handle guest escalations.
Profile Management and Support for all Private Residents
- The Residential Coordinator will review and audit all aspects of Residential homeowner profiles, ensuring accurate data and providing relevant property support.
- Review profiles to ensure Residential profile enrichment is being carried out by the local Residential teams.
- Lead periodic audits and updates on Residential Profile initiatives, including regular audits to ensure the correct homeowners are enrolled and removed.
- Support global Residential teams by auditing/updates upon request.
- Provide regional and corporate leaders with reports on KPIs, tracking and audit results.
